Transaction 793b34b28cd4c3d4d53e456c2e59adbd91ccedc6a332bff9965c428acd08ff86
1 Input
2 Outputs
- 793b34b28cd4c3d4d53e456c2e59adbd91ccedc6a332bff9965c428acd08ff86:0
- 793b34b28cd4c3d4d53e456c2e59adbd91ccedc6a332bff9965c428acd08ff86:1
value 17438169
address 12bFEwwFSorYwCC36Km8JEpErx5vWVmEZx
value 2524700
address 3DSbWJ8CDV6N8T8MfJx6JnvKDH8NaNcXgr